KARACHI, March 21: Sindh Chief Minister Syed Qaim Ali Shah said Wednesday that the PPP-led government would continue to respect and uphold the freedom of the press.

Speaking at a ceremony held at the CM House to present a Rs50 million cheque to the Karachi Union of Journalists for setting up a journalists’ endowment fund, Mr Shah said the PPP and its governments had always stood by journalists in their struggle for securing their rights.

He said the government would continue to play its role in ensuring that journalists got their due rights and expressed the hope that journalists too would discharge their professional duties with ‘responsibility’. KUJ president G.M. Jamali thanked the government for providing the money and said the endowment fund would go a long way in addressing problems faced by the media personnel.
